Ajmeri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Ajmeri Village has a population of 2.79 k (2,786) with 1.44 k (1,443) males and 1.34 k (1,343) females.The sex ratio in Ajmeri is 931,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Ajmeri Village is 445 (445) which is 15.97% of Ajmeri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Ajmeri Village is 910 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Ajmeri village is listed as part of the Neem-Ka-Thana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Sikar District in the state of RAJASTHAN in INDIA.
The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Ajmeri Literacy Rate
Ajmeri Village has a literacy rate of 67.71%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Ajmeri Village is 83.22 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Ajmeri Village is 51.11 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Ajmeri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Ajmeri Village is 434 (434) with 217 (217) males and 217 (217) females, which is 15.58% of Ajmeri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 1000 females for every 1000 males.
Ajmeri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Ajmeri Village is 252 (252) with 133 (133) males and 119 (119) females, which is 9.05% of Ajmeri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 895 females for every 1000 males.

Ajmeri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Ajmeri Village, there are about 1.10 k (1,099) workers, making up nearly 39.45% of the Ajmeri Village total population. Out of these, around 657 (657) are male workers, and about 442 (442) are female workers.
